I. Homeschooling 101 – Tuesday, May 19, 2009 Angie opened the meeting with a prayer and general information: Notification forms - These do not need to be done for e-schools. On the form for section #6 – 7, it indicates to include a brief outline of the courses and textbooks. Everyone doe these differently and a parent might just send the contents of the text books being used.
